Summary

This position is primarily responsible for providing visionary, creative and energetic leadership focused on supporting the growth and development of the Sorority's educational programs and REAL Leadership initiatives.


Responsibilities

Core duties and respon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Manage Education staff.
  • Oversee training, development and performance management of all education staff members.
  • Conduct weekly one-on-one meetings and regular team meetings.
  • Supervise and direct all Sorority educational programs and REAL Leadership initiatives to support Gamma Phi Beta's strategic priorities, mission and vision.
  • Support the chief experience officer by facilitating forward-thinking, data-informed strategies to further Gamma Phi Beta's educational programs and REAL Leadership initiatives.
  • Create and revise education procedures to establish systematic and routine approaches to improve delivery of educational programs and REAL Leadership initiatives.
  • Lead program assessments for all educational programs and REAL Leadership initiatives. Based on program assessments, adjust to increase learning or improve delivery.
  • Maintain Gamma Phi Beta's member competencies, mapping educational program and REAL Leadership initiatives to member competency development. Periodically review and propose changes and updates, as necessary.
  • Direct Gamma Phi Beta's educational programs and resources for belonging, equity, diversity and inclusion (BEDI).
  • Source and secure contracts with keynote speakers and other external partners for educational programs and REAL Leadership events.
  • Develop and maintain collaborative relationships with other departments to successfully deliver educational programs and REAL Leadership events.
  • Attend Sorority events (virtual and in person) to support program delivery.
  • Provide periodic reports and recommendations to Gamma Phi Beta's three boards: International Council(IC), Facilities Management Company(FMC)Board of Managers and Foundation Board of Trustees.
  • Serve as a member of the Member Experience division leadership team.
  • Oversee the creation and delivery of asynchronous e-learning courses including leading course development strategy, determining user interface priorities for member engagement within the Sorority's learning management system (LMS) and collaborating with internal and external stakeholders to troubleshoot LMS support needs.
  • Recruit, hire, train and support facilitators for educational programs and REAL Leadership initiatives to ensure consistent program delivery and alignment with Gamma Phi Beta's learning objectives.
  • Manage department budget.
  • Attend/represent the Sorority at conferences, workshops and trainings.
Education/Experience


Bachelor's degree from four-year college or university in related degree program; master's degree in higher education and/or human development preferred; five to seven years of related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ience. Two to four years of supervisory experience is desired.

Location

This position may be based at Gamma Phi Beta Sorority Headquarters in Centennial, Colorado, or performed remotely. Preferred candidates will live within 30 miles of an airport.

Benefits and Compensation


Compensation is commensurate with experience, education and location. The hiring range for this role is $65,000 to $75,000 annually. Gamma Phi Beta offers a full benefits package with an excellent paid time off package that includes 15 days of vacation plus sick time, personal days, holidays and two weeks of additional paid time off over the office's winter break. Benefits include health, life, disability, vision and dental insurance coverage and participation in Gamma Phi Beta's 401(k) plan after a year of eligible service.
